#b61ec6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b61ec6 is composed of 71.4% red, 11.8%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.1% cyan, 84.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 294.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.7% and a lightness of 44.7%. #b61ec6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3cff with #6d008d.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#b61ec6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b61ec6 has RGB values of R:182, G:30,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 11935430.

Shades and Tints of #b61ec6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a020b is the darkest color, while #fef9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b61ec6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#766d77 is the less saturated color, while #cb04e0 is the most saturated one.
